The most famous American battles of WW1 were the Battle of Cantigny fought on May 28, 1918, Chateau-Thierry fought on June 3, 1918, the Battle of Belleau Wood fought between June 6, 1918 - June 26, 1918, the Battle of St. Mihiel that was fought on September 12, 1918. read more
